SUMMARY:Raven's Cry Theatre: Garibaldi Trio
DESCRIPTION:The Garibaldi Trio returns to Sechelt for their third performance for the Coast Recital Society. Founded in 2022 at the initiative of the late Frances Heinsheimer Wainwright the Garibaldi Trio brings together violinist-violist Marina Thibeault\, clarinetist Jose Franch-Ballester\, and pianist David Fung. The concert will celebrate the release of the trio’s brand new CD – “Faded Sepia” – on the ATMA label. The new album – and the concert – will feature two works commissioned by the CRS specially for the trio – Stephen Chatman’s “Garibaldi Trio” and the world premiere of “Persistence” by Dorothy Chang.

SUMMARY:Ravens Cry Theatre: Film Showing: The Friend
DESCRIPTION:USA 2024\, 119 min\, Drama\nDirector: Scott McGehee\nStarring: Bill Murray\, Naomi Watts\, Cloé Xhauflaire \nWhat’s going to happen to the dog? That becomes the central question in this gently paced exploration of friendship and grief\, both human and canine. The film stars Naomi Watts in a nuanced performance as Iris\, with a supporting role from Bill Murray as Walter. \nWhen Walter dies\, he bequeaths the care of his Great Dane\, Apollo\, to his friend Iris\, who tries to resist caring for this very large dog\, partly due to her small New York apartment but also due to her need to work from home as a writer. Apollo is disruptive to her life and her work. As the story progresses\, both woman and dog create a bond that resists separation and each finds comfort in this new relationship.

SUMMARY:Raven's Cry Theatre: National Theatre Live: Dr. Strangelove
DESCRIPTION:Or How I learned to Stop Worrying and Love the Bomb. Seven-time BAFTA Award-winner Steve Coogan plays four roles in the world premiere stage adaptation of Stanley Kubrick’s comedy masterpiece Dr. Strangelove. This explosively funny satire\, about a rogue U.S General who triggers a nuclear attack. Based on the motion picture directed by Stanley Kubrick\, screenplay by Stanley Kubrick\, Terry Southern and Peter George\, based on the book ‘Red Alert’ by Peter George.

SUMMARY:Raven’s Cry Theatre: FILM SHOWING: So Surreal: Behind the Masks
DESCRIPTION:Canada 2024\, 88 min\, Documentary\nDirector: Neil Diamond\, Joanne Robertson\nA fascinating film documenting the search for Indigenous Northwest artifacts that were taken from their places of origin by trade\, sale\, and theft. Some items travelled long journeys\, ending up in New York antique stores or in the studios and homes of European Surrealists\, such as Max Ernst and others\, whose works distinctly reveal the influence of these masks.\nCree director Neil Diamond\, accompanied by a team of interested parties including cultural preservation workers and art experts\, embarks on an investigative journey that illuminates the efforts to repatriate Indigenous art. The film is as engaging as a detective story and is enhanced by vivid imagery and interviews with the compassionate searchers

SUMMARY:Disinformation in Canada -- free public event from ElderCollege
DESCRIPTION:Free but must register here. \nDr. Ahmed Al-Rawi from SFU’s Disinformation Project research unit will deliver the free 2025 Clifford Smith Memorial Lecture on Saturday\, September 13\, at 14:00 at Raven’s Cry Theatre\, Sechelt. \nThis free\, all ages\, public lecture will help you understand disinformation and the disruptions it presents in our digital era. What is fact and what is false? Using examples from Canadian and international media\, Dr. Al-Rawi will focus on the spread of both misinformation and disinformation\, how to navigate the challenges of identifying false information\, and some ways to protect ourselves against it.

SUMMARY:Raven’s Cry: FILM SHOWING: The Marching Band
DESCRIPTION:France 2024\, 103 min\, Drama\nDirector: Emmanuel Courcol\nStarring: Banjamin Lavernhe\, Pierre Lottin\, Sarah Suco \nFrench with English subtitles \nThibaut is a world-renowned conductor who travels the globe. Being diagnosed with leukemia\, he finds that he needs a bone marrow transplant and learns that he was adopted. He then discovers the existence of a brother\, Jimmy\, a factory worker who plays the trombone in a brass band\, and seeks him out. On the surface\, everything seems to separate them\, except for their love of music. Detecting his brother’s exceptional musical talent\, Thibaut takes it upon himself to rectify the injustice of fate. \nThe story provides a look into contrasting musical cultures\, and how they may be both different and yet the same.
